OHIO PIONEER; of AMISH ANCESTRY; MOTHER OF FIFTEEN CHILDREN

Sophia was a daughter of George B. FURRY and Elizabeth LAVENBURG, both of Pennsylvania Dutch (German) ancestry. Her father served in the War of 1812.

Sophia relocated with her parents and family from Pennsylvania to Perry County, Ohio in 1824.

Sophia married Richard Pierce NUZUM at Somerset (near Zanesfield), Perry Co., Ohio on 4 December 1831 [Perry Co., Ohio, Vital Records, Marriages].

Sophia and Richard raised fifteen children in Perry Co., Ohio, all are linked in Find-A-Grave.

Sophia and Richard were enumerated by the 1840 US Census at Somerset, where they had married.

Sophia, a Lutheran, encouraged her husband to join the Lutheran church and to raise their children as Lutherans. Their son George W. attended a Methodist Meeting in 1850 and was quickly converted to Methodism. Richard, who was a stern and exacting man, and George became estranged. Sophia had to mediate their serious rift.

Sophia and Richard were enumerated by the 1850, 1860, 1870, and 1880 US Censuses at Monroe, Perry Co., Ohio. There they operated a family farm.

She was survived by her husband and nine of her children.

Children (all born in Perry Co., Ohio); surname Nuzum:

1. George Washington (1832-1912). He married Mary Fletcher GROVES.
2. Joseph, twin, was born in 1833; died 3 days later.
3. Henry, twin, was born in 1833; died 3 days later.
4. Elizabeth Jane, (1835-1853). She was engaged to Eli McDowell GROVES.
5. Cynthia Ann (1837-1894). She married John Nelson POST, a Civil War Veteran.
6. Joel Martin (1839-1925); Civil War Veteran. He married Frances SHOTWELL.
7. David P. (1841-1895); Civil War Veteran. He married Hannah GRIMM.
8. Benjamin Franklin (1842-1855).
9. Ruth Manena (1844-1847).
10. Rebecca Frances (1847-1849).
11. Ottoria Almeda (1848-1937). He married Benjamin MAXWELL.
12. Charles Richard Lehman (1852-1899). He married first Mary Frances WARD. He married second Caroline A. ELLIOTT.
13. William F. (1854-1930). He married Amanda B. RODGERS.
14. Anna (1856-1939). She married David S. WEAVER.
15. Thomas Benton (1862-1939). He married Amanda Lucinda MARSHALL.

Source: Charles E. Haggerty, The Nuzum Family History Revised, David G. Nuzum, Publisher, Keyser, West Virginia, p. 219-222, 1983.
